What is the function of the Lenticels? In plant bodies that produce secondary growth, lenticels promote the gas exchange of oxygen, carbon dioxide, and water vapor. It functions as a pore, providing a medium for the direct exchange of gases between the internal tissues and atmosphere.
What are Lenticels and its function? In plant bodies that produce secondary growth, lenticels promote gas exchange of oxygen, carbon dioxide, and water vapor.
Lenticels are found as raised circular, oval, or elongated areas on stems and roots.
In woody plants, lenticels commonly appear as rough, cork-like structures on young branches.

How Lenticels are formed?
Lenticels in plants are tiny raised pores, typically elliptical. They develop from woody stems when the epidermis is substituted by the bark or cork. This tissue occupies the lenticels and emerges from cell division in the substomatal ground tissue.
What is the difference between stomata and Lenticels?
The main difference between stomata and lenticels is that stomata mainly occur in the lower epidermis of leaves, whereas lenticels occur in the periderm of the woody trunk or stems. Stomata occur during the primary growth of the plant while lenticels occur during the secondary growth of the plant.

What are the functions of stomata?
Stomata are composed of a pair of specialized epidermal cells referred to as guard cells (Figure 3). Stomata regulate gas exchange between the plant and environment and control of water loss by changing the size of the stomatal pore.
Why Lenticels are called breathing pores?
All trees have small pores called lenticels scattered over their bark, although they are more noticeable on some trees than on others. Lenticels serve as “breathing holes”, allowing oxygen to enter the living cells of the bark tissue.

Where are Lenticels found?
The lenticels found on the epidermis of different plant organs (stem, petiole, fruits) made up of parenchymatous cells are pores that always remain open, in contrast to stomata, which regulate their extent of opening. Lenticels are visible on fruit surfaces, such as mango, apple, and avocado.

Do Lenticels have guard cells?
Lenticels do not have guard cells. Stomata are giving out a large amount of water vapour to the atmosphere. Lenticels permit a small amount of water vapour to the atmosphere. Stomata are not found in fruits and roots.
